Excel表格竖列大写字母序号怎么变成横列 表格数字大写怎么复制

编辑:
发布时间: 2023-10-13 02:13:42
分享:

目录导航:

Excel表格竖列大写字母序号怎么变成横列excel如何将数字快速变成会计大写Excel表格竖列大写字母序号怎么变成横列

Excel表格竖列大写字母序号变成横列的方法步骤如下:首先选择需要竖排的文字,进行复制,并点击任意单元格—右击单元格,选择其中的“选择性黏贴”-粘贴内容转置,就可以了。如果我们把一个单元个竖排的文字变成横排

选择单元格,右击-选择“设置单元格格式” 。打开“设置单元格格式”,-选择“对齐”样式,在窗口右侧的方向中,设置文本方向,点击确认按钮,就完成了。

要将Excel表格中竖列的大写字母序号变成横列,可以按照以下步骤操作:

1. 选中需要进行转换的竖列,例如选中A、B、C列。

2. 右键点击选中的列,在弹出的菜单中选择"复制"。

3. 在表格中选择要粘贴的目标位置,通常是希望转换后的横列之前或之后的位置。

4. 右键点击目标位置,在弹出的菜单中选择"选择性粘贴"。

5. 在"选择性粘贴"对话框中,选择"转置"选项,然后点击"确定"。

这样就可以将竖列的大写字母序号转换成横列了。请注意,转换后的横列会保留原来竖列的数据内容,并且在转换后可能需要重新调整表格的布局和格式。

excel如何将数字快速变成会计大写

在 Excel 中,可以使用 VBA 宏来将数字快速转换为会计大写。以下是具体步骤:

1. 打开 Excel,按下“Alt+F11”键,打开 VBA 编辑器。

2. 在 VBA 编辑器中,选择“插入”菜单下的“模块”选项,插入一个新的模块。

3. 在新的模块中,输入以下 VBA 代码:

```

Function ConvertCurrencyToEnglish(ByVal MyNumber)

Dim Dollars, Cents, Temp

Dim DecimalPlace, Count

ReDim Place(9) As String

Place(2) = " Thousand "

Place(3) = " Million "

Place(4) = " Billion "

Place(5) = " Trillion "

MyNumber = Trim(Str(MyNumber))

DecimalPlace = InStr(MyNumber, ".")

If DecimalPlace > 0 Then

Cents = GetTens(Left(Mid(MyNumber, DecimalPlace + 1) & "00", 2))

MyNumber = Trim(Left(MyNumber, DecimalPlace - 1))

End If

Count = 1

Do While MyNumber <> ""

Temp = GetHundreds(Right(MyNumber, 3))

If Temp <> "" Then Dollars = Temp & Place(Count) & Dollars

If Len(MyNumber) > 3 Then

MyNumber = Left(MyNumber, Len(MyNumber) - 3)

Else

MyNumber = ""

End If

Count = Count + 1

Loop

Select Case Dollars

在Excel中将数字快速转换为会计大写,可以通过以下步骤实现:

在单元格中输入需要转换的数字,例如:1234.56。

在另一个单元格中输入以下公式:=TEXT(A1,"¥#,##0.00")。其中,A1是需要转换的数字所在的单元格。

将公式复制到需要转换的所有单元格中。

选中所有需要转换为会计大写的单元格,然后在“开始”选项卡中找到“数值”分组下的“数值格式”命令,单击下拉箭头并选择“自定义”。

在弹出的“格式单元格”对话框中,在“类型”字段中输入以下格式代码:[=0]"人民币零元整";[>0]¥#,##0.00_);¥#,##0.00。然后单击“确定”。

现在,选中的所有单元格中的数字都已转换为会计大写。

注意:以上公式和格式代码是以人民币为单位的,如果需要转换其他货币的金额,请相应地修改格式代码中的货币符号和单位。

相关阅读
热门精选
皮肤 你的